Abstract
A frequency reconfigurable dual-band monopole antenna for WLAN and WiMAX applications is presented. The proposed antenna based on complementary split-ring (CSR) resonators provides single or dual frequency operation that is tunable using an integrated radio-frequency switch. The antenna is electrically small, thanks to the CSR structures, and exhibits well-behaved radiation patterns in both E- and H-planes. The antenna design, simulation, and measurement results are presented. The simulated and measured results are in good agreement. (c) 2014 Wiley Periodicals, Inc.
